Abstract
The present invention relates to a kind of auxiliary hoisting device and using method, including slide plate, running roller car, running roller car slides on slide plate, described running roller car includes vehicle frame, support arm, bearing pin, steamboat, vehicle frame is triangular structure, and two ends are provided with steamboat, and the intermediate ends of two vehicle frames connects by bearing pin is fixing, support arm one end is movably hinged with bearing pin, and the support arm other end is fork-shaped;Described slide plate includes base plate, portable plate, plate, and base plate is movably hinged with portable plate, and plate is fixed on portable plate.Crane is sling the other end of steel sheet pile, and running roller car is followed steel sheet pile and moved on slide plate, and along with steel sheet pile is constantly lifted, running roller car is walked in the U-lag of steel sheet pile, until steel sheet pile departs from running roller car.Advantage is: achieve safty hoisting steel sheet pile, due to running roller car support steel sheet pile, thus without friction lower floor steel sheet pile, will not produce noise, also steel sheet pile will not be caused damage simultaneously, facilitate the handling of steel sheet pile.

Background technology
At present, the operation of slinging of Common Steels sheet pile is all directly to sling with chuck or suspension hook, and such lifting mode not only produces huge
Big noise, and during slinging, steel sheet pile is produced damage, make steel sheet pile deform, cause damage.
Seeing Fig. 1, steel sheet pile is when slinging, and the weight of whole steel sheet pile concentrates on 2 stress points, and along with crane constantly rises
High forward slip, produces noise, and both sides bent angle is easily deformed, and impact uses, and repairs to get up to waste time and energy, Er Qieji
Dangerous, easily operator are damaged.

Detailed description of the invention
Below in conjunction with Figure of description, the present invention is described in detail, it should be noted that the enforcement of the present invention be not limited to
Under embodiment.
Seeing Fig. 2-Fig. 6, a kind of auxiliary hoisting device, including slide plate 3, running roller car 2, running roller car 2 slides on slide plate 3,
Described running roller car 2 includes that vehicle frame 21, support arm 22, bearing pin 23, steamboat 24, vehicle frame 21 are triangular structure, two
End is provided with steamboat 24, and the intermediate ends of two vehicle frames 21 connects by bearing pin 23 is fixing, lives with bearing pin 23 in support arm 22 one end
Dynamic hinged, support arm 22 other end is fork-shaped, and steamboat 24 rolls on slide plate 3;Described slide plate 3 include base plate 31,
Portable plate 32, plate 33, base plate 31 is movably hinged with portable plate 32, and plate 33 is fixed on portable plate 32.
Wherein, the slot width D of plate 33 matches with steel sheet pile 1 bottom thickness.Base plate 31 both sides are fixed with limiting plate
34.Running roller car 2 width is less than steel sheet pile 1 inner width W.Support arm 22 can use triangular structure, sees Fig. 4, Fig. 5,
Two support arms 22 are spacing fixing by round bar, and first angle of triangle is movably hinged with bearing pin, and second angle is fork-shaped knot
Structure, the 3rd angle is connected with each other by round bar, and this structure can make support arm 22 avoid occurring excessively to overturn, triangle simultaneously
Shape structure is more stable, it is to avoid support arm 22 operationally deforms.
The using method of auxiliary hoisting device, comprises the following steps:
1) fork configuration of running roller car 2 support arm 22 inserts the edge, the end of top layer steel sheet pile 1 one end, and running roller car 2 is placed on cunning
On plate 3, the plate 33 of slide plate 3 inserting the edge, steel sheet pile 1 end of the second layer, base plate 31 end is placed in ground, is formed tiltedly
Slope;
2) crane is sling the other end of steel sheet pile 1, while steel sheet pile 1 is sling, under the restriction of fork configuration, roller
Wheel car 2 is followed steel sheet pile 1 and is moved on slide plate 3, and along with steel sheet pile 1 is constantly lifted, running roller car 2 is by portable plate 32
Walking in the U-lag of steel sheet pile 1, until steel sheet pile 1 departs from running roller car 2, whole process running roller car 2 plays support
Effect.
Owing to the supporting arm of running roller car 2 is movably hinged with vehicle frame 21, therefore support arm 22 can become according to the angle sling
Change.Running roller car 2 uses 4 wheel constructions, can be more steady in base plate 31 and steel sheet pile 1 walk.Portable plate 32 and base plate
31 can realize being movably hinged by hinge, and angle when therefore slide plate 3 can be placed according to steel sheet pile 1 is adjusted, and forms ground
Face is to the oblique extradition face on steel sheet pile 1.
Present invention achieves safty hoisting steel sheet pile 1, due to running roller car 2 support steel sheet pile 1, thus without friction lower floor steel
Sheet pile 1, will not produce noise, also steel sheet pile 1 will not be caused damage simultaneously, facilitate the handling of steel sheet pile 1.
Being movably hinged with vehicle frame 21 due to support arm 22 during handling, therefore support arm 22 can change along with steel sheet pile 1
Support angle, facilitates handling;Limiting plate 34 plays position-limiting action, it is to avoid running roller car 2 deviates base plate 31 and moves.
